COMPTON, Calif. – Deputies in Los Angeles County are responding to a possible active-shooting situation in Compton.
The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department responded to a call near the intersection of South Cahita Avenue and East Rosecrans Avenue Thursday night. According to LASD, a man is believed to be standing on a roof holding a shotgun.
Homes near the area are being ordered to evacuate as authorities fear he may have been shooting at random.
Officials have not released the identity of the suspect.
As of 8:30 p.m., officials did not say if injuries were reported in the incident. FOX 11 is making calls to see if any innocent bystanders are hurt in the incident.
